ManagementExecutive OfficersWalter ScottWalter Scott has served as our Director since June 2007 and our Chief Executive Officer since September 2005. From May 2005 to September 2005, Mr. Scott worked as VP of Product Management for Quest Software following
the acquisition of Imceda Software where Mr. Scott served as President and Chief Executive Officer from January 2004 to May 2005. From January 2000 to January 2004, Mr. Scott worked as Vice President of Sales for Embarcadero Technologies. Earlier in his career Mr. Scott was honorably discharged from the U.S. Army and held a variety of sales and marketing positions at BMC Software and Banyan Systems. Mr. Scott received a B.A. in 1990 and a M.B.A. in 1990 from the University of Maine. |  | John P. MurgoJohn P. Murgo has served as our Secretary since June 2007 and Executive Vice President and Chief Financial Officer since April 2006. Prior to joining us, from December 2003 to April 2006, Mr. Murgo served as Executive Vice
President and Chief Financial Officer of OpenService, Inc. From February 2001 to April 2003, Mr. Murgo worked as Chief Financial Officer of Dirig Software. Prior to that Mr. Murgo held various roles at Process Software Corporation, or Process Software, including President and Chief Executive Officer [in 2000] and, prior to that, Vice-President of Operations and Chief Financial Officer from March 1995 to May 2000. Prior to that Mr. Murgo was Vice President of Finance and Chief Financial Officer of HPSC Inc., a publicly traded company from 1989 to 1994. Before joining Process Software, he was employed at PricewaterhouseCoopers from 1983 to 1989. Mr. Murgo received a B.S. in Accounting from Bentley College in 1982. Mr. Murgo is a certified public accountant of inactive status. |  | Ellan MurphyEllan Murphy has served as our Vice President of Sales since September 2005. Prior to joining us, from May 2005 to August 2005, Ms. Murphy served as Director of Sales of Quest Software following the acquisition of Imceda Software where she served as Vice President of Sales from January 2004 to May 2005. From April 2000 to January 2004, Ms. Murphy worked as Director of Sales for Embarcadero Technologies. Earlier in her career, Ms. Murphy held sales positions at IBM, Oracle and BMC Software. Ms. Murphy received a B.A. in 1973 from Kent State University and an M.A. in 1979 from Rutgers University. |  | Ed HarnishEd Harnish has served as our Vice President of Marketing since September 2005. Prior to joining us, from May 2005 to August 2005, Mr. Harnish served as Director of Marketing at Quest Software. From May 2004 to May 2005, Mr. Harnish served as Vice President of Marketing at Imceda Software. Mr. Harnish worked as Director of Marketing for Biscom, Inc., a document management company, from May 2002 to May 2004. From February 2000 to May of 2002 he held the position of Vice President, Marketing at Aptus Technologies, Inc., a fiber optic Manufacturer. Earlier in his career, Mr. Harnish held positions at Heroix, Inc., RAScom, Banyan Systems, and Victor Technologies. Mr. Harnish served in the U.S. Air force and was honorably discharged in 1979. |  | Ed BenackEd Benack has served as our Chief Information Officer and Chief Customer Officer since January 2008. Prior to joining us, Ed was Senior Vice President of the Customer Experience and Service for Monster Worldwide for three years. From 1998-2005, he served as Microsoft Corporation's General Manager of Customer Service for North American and Asia where he delivered award-winning service. From 1996-1998, he held senior roles within Microsoft's Information Technology Group (Engineering, Planning & Business Operations). From 1988-1996, Ed was a Staff Director for NYNEX Corporation (now Verizon), where he managed the design & implementation of voice, data, & video networks. He also held roles in their Information Services, Quality Measurements, and Technical Training groups. 1985-1988, Ed was an Army Officer stationed in Germany. His experiences included serving as a German Liaison Officer and leading an anti-tank platoon. Ed holds a Bachelor of Arts (B.A.) in Theoretical Mathematics & Political Science from Bucknell University (1985) and an MBA from Hofstra University (1995). Ed.Benack@acronis.com |  |

Mr. Scott received a B.A. in 1990 and a M.B.A. in 1990 from the University of Maine. |  | Serguei BeloussovSerguei Beloussov is one of our founders and has served as our Director since our inception. Mr. Beloussov is an entrepreneur who has founded and managed a number of technology companies in North America, Europe and Asia. Mr. Beloussov currently serves as the Chairman and Chief Executive Officer of SWsoft, a virtualization and server automation software company. In addition, Mr. Beloussov founded Sunrise Electronics, one of the first computer manufacturing businesses in Russia, Rolsen Electronics, a consumer electronics and computer parts distribution business, and Solomon Software SEA, an exclusive franchising distributor of Solomon Software in Southeast Asia. Mr. Beloussov holds a B.S. in Physics and a M.S. in Physics and Electrical Engineering from the Moscow Institute of Physics and Technology (MIPT). |  | John M. GoldsmithJohn M. Goldsmith has served as our Director since September 2007. John Goldsmith is an investor in early-stage and growth companies and is on the board of directors of each of Gerson Lehrman Group and Lux Research. Through the end of 1999 he was a partner of AEA Investors Inc., which he joined in 1989. Mr. Goldsmith is a certified public accountant of inactive status. He received a M.B.A. in finance from New York University's Stern School of Business in 1989 and received his A.B. from Princeton University in 1985. |  | Ravi JacobRavi Jacob is vice president and treasurer of Intel Corporation. He was named treasurer in April 2005. In this role he manages Intel's cash and investments, capital markets activity, currency and other financial risks, credit and collections, retirement assets and risk and insurance. Prior to his appointment as treasurer, Ravi was Vice President, Finance and Asst. Treasurer, M&A. For seven years he led a worldwide team of approximately 50 treasury professionals responsible for structuring and executing Intel Capital's acquisitions, divestitures and strategic investment transactions. Ravi has held several management positions within Intel's treasury organization. From 1994-1998 he worked as assistant treasurer, Europe. In prior roles he managed the company's retirement investments portfolio and overseas cash management activities. Ravi joined Intel in 1984. He holds a master's degree in business administration from UCLA. |  | Scott MaxwellScott Maxwell has served as our Director since 2004. Mr. Maxwell is a Managing Partner and Director of OpenView Venture Partners. Prior to joining OpenView Venture Partners, Mr. Maxwell was a Managing Partner at Insight Venture Partners. Mr. Maxwell received a B.S. and M.S. in Mechanical Engineering from the University of California, Davis, a Ph.D. from M.I.T. in Mechanical Engineering (Sigma Xi) and a M.B.A. from M.I.T. Sloan School of Management. |  | Michael TriplettMichael Triplett has served as our Director since 2004. Mr. Triplett serves as a Managing Director of Insight Venture Partners. Prior to joining Insight Venture Partners in 1998, Mr. Triplett was an investment professional at Summit Partners, where he focused on investments in infrastructure and enterprise application software companies. Mr. Triplett received his B.A. in Economics from Dartmouth College in 1996. |  | Ilya ZubarevIlya Zubarev has served as our Director since June 2007. Mr. Zubarev is a founder of SWsoft, Rolsen and Infra Telesystems. Mr. Zubarev received his B.S. in Physics in 1993 and his M.S. in Physics and Electrical Engineering from Moscow Institute of Physics and Technology in 1995. |
